What a PQR-Based Review Considers

PQR means Professional Qualification Requirements. A profile-based review considers factors relevant to an intended authority route; it is not final authority approval.

Authority and title

Target authority, professional category, title and specialty context.

Qualification and experience

Education, graduation timing, clinical history and recent practice.

Professional history

Licence, registration, good-standing and previous UAE pathway context.

Case route

New application, renewal, transfer, verification or assessment context.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

Starting too early

Proceeding before checking the relevant authority, professional category and individual profile.

Using a generic checklist

Assuming one route has identical requirements to every authority and profession.

Incomplete readiness

Moving forward without clear document, experience or professional-history context.

Verification assumptions

Assuming a DataFlow or PSV route, outcome or transfer option without checking the case.

Assessment assumptions

Assuming an exam, evaluation or interview result before independent authority review.

Automatic-outcome assumptions

Assuming approval, a fixed timeline or a particular licensing outcome.

What is PQR in UAE healthcare licensing?

PQR means Professional Qualification Requirements, used as a basis for considering qualification, experience, licensure and title factors.

Why should I check PQR before applying?

It can help you understand the appropriate route before spending on the wrong application.

Which authorities use PQR-based eligibility?

PQR context can be relevant to DHA, MOHAP, DOH, SHA and other authority pathways.
